DESCRIPTION:This week's speaker is:\n\nWilliam Xu\, PhD Candidate\, Materia
 ls Science and Engineering\, Stanford University\n"Adaptive Mineral Blendi
 ng and Routing Using Reinforcement Learning"\n\nAbstract:\n\nEfficient min
 eral processing is vital to sustainably source the critical minerals neede
 d for national security and the clean energy transition. Ore variability i
 s a major source of uncertainty that limits mineral processing performance
  and is often addressed by blending feedstocks together to make them more 
 homogenous and consistent. In this work\, I use reinforcement learning to 
 solve the problem of feedstock blending and routing under uncertainty in t
 he context of phosphate mining operations in Morocco.\n\n\nBio:\n\nWilliam
  Xu (he/him) is a PhD candidate in Materials Science and Engineering in th
 e Mineral-X research group (supervised by Prof. Jef Caers). He applies AI 
 to optimize mineral processing under uncertainty with the goal of making p
 rocessing more efficient and sustainable. As a RAISE fellow\, William is w
 orking with Imperial Valley Equity and Justice to devise community-centere
 d economic development plans in the “Lithium Valley” region of souther
